| Role | Description |
|---|---|
| Early Childhood Educator | Implement positive discipline strategies in preschools or daycare centers to foster a nurturing and respectful learning environment. |
| Parenting Coach | Guide parents in applying positive discipline techniques to build strong, healthy relationships with their children. |
| Child Development Specialist | Work with families and educators to promote positive behavior and emotional growth in young children. |
| Workshop Facilitator | Conduct training sessions and workshops for educators and parents on positive discipline principles and practices. |
| Curriculum Developer | Design educational programs and materials that incorporate positive discipline strategies for early childhood settings. |
| Family Support Specialist | Provide resources and support to families to help them navigate challenges using positive discipline approaches. |
| Consultant for Early Childhood Programs | Advise schools and organizations on integrating positive discipline into their policies and practices. |
